Transaction 67fb2328a5655f4e94d20f200008c07862e1229eaa77bc788c5bdc693ac93661
1 Input
1 Output
-
67fb2328a5655f4e94d20f200008c07862e1229eaa77bc788c5bdc693ac93661:0
- value
- 133430
- script pubkey
- OP_0 OP_PUSHBYTES_20 5aaf16b640fee7982602bb6b19adcbb2492a5984
- address
- bc1qt2h3ddjqlmnesfszhd43ntwtkfyj5kvy2h58sy